Full documentation of the params.json configuration file

Simulator_params: Simulation parameters

working_directory: Path where results will be saved format: str e.g: "/scratch/users/thatomanamela/Results/testing/"

trecs_params_file: simuCLASS congfig file being used format: str e.g: "stackingdepth2.ini"

msfile_name: Simulated measurement set name format: str e.g: "MeerKAT_3GHz_TRECS_srcs_RA0deg_Dec-30deg.MS"

ra_deg0: Right Ascension at the phase centre of the observation in units of degrees format: float
e.g: 0

dec_deg0: Declination at the phase centre of the observation in units of degrees format: float e.g: 30

obs_length_hr: Observation length in hours format: int e.g: 1

nchan: Number of channels format: int e.g: 16

dtime_s: Intergration time in seconds format: int e.g: 8

freq0_MHz: Observational frequency format: str e.g "3000MHz"

dfreq_MHz: "0.209MHz" integration frequency SEFD_Jy: 450 the system equivalent flux densit in Jy }

Stacking_params:{ parameters when stacking a certain number of sources to avoid confusion stacking_depth?: false should be kept false when No._of_srcs_of_choice? is true res_element_per_source: 100 the number of resolution elements per source im_noise_Jy: 3e-6 MeerKAT's Full image noise stacking_depth_skymodel_name: "stack_auto/trecs-simu_truthcat.txt" FOV_size_cut?: false
FOV_size_sqdeg: 0.84 MeerKAT's FOV size in sq-deg FOV_size_cut_value: 0.5 sources will be generated within 50% of the FOV if FOV_size_cut? is true No._of_srcs_of_choice?: true when resolutions elements per source is not prefered No._of_srcs: 10 flux density of choices provided No._of_srcs_of_choice? is true flux_density_Jy: 1e-6 flux density of choices provided No._of_srcs_of_choice? is true src_size_arcsec: 0 when 0 TRECS source sizes are used }

Imaging_params:{ Imaging parameters when removing bright sources before stacking stack_msfile_name: "uvstacked.ms" name of the visibility stacked measurement set imagename: "fullimage" name the full image of the observation simulation when removing bright sources niter: 1000 CLEAN number of interations threshold: "0.01mJy" maximum flux density to CLEANout imsize: 3136 size of the full image stampsize: 64 size of uv stacked image cell: "1arcsec" pixel size stack_clean?: true True for removing bright sources weighting: "briggs" CLEAN weighting robust: -0.5 weighting robust parameters
